<title>power: supply: bq25890: fix the -10 C NTC lookup entry</title>

The TSPCT lookup table is monotonically decreasing except for ADC code
121, where the sequence reads -9.0 C, -1.0 C, -12.0 C.  This makes the
reported battery temperature jump upward by eight degrees for one code
and then downward by eleven degrees for the next code.

The entry is a missing zero: use -10.0 C so the sequence remains
monotonic between -9.0 C and -12.0 C.

<title>power: supply: max17040: handle missing status supplier</title>

MAX17040 does not report charger state itself, so the driver forwards
POWER_SUPPLY_PROP_STATUS to a supplier power supply. If no supplier is
registered, power_supply_get_property_from_supplier() returns -ENODEV and
leaves the output value untouched.

max17040_get_property() currently ignores that error and returns success,
so userspace can read an uninitialized status value from the battery power
supply. This happens on systems that use the fuel gauge without a charger
supplier relationship in firmware.

Return POWER_SUPPLY_STATUS_UNKNOWN when no supplier provides STATUS, and
propagate other supplier lookup errors.

<title>power: sequencing: fix ABBA deadlock in pwrseq_device_unregister()</title>

The pwrseq core takes three locks in consistent order everywhere:

  pwrseq_sem -&gt; pwrseq-&gt;rw_lock -&gt; pwrseq-&gt;state_lock

pwrseq_get() -&gt; pwrseq_match_device() takes pwrseq_sem for reading, then
rw_lock for reading. pwrseq_power_on()/pwrseq_power_off() take rw_lock
for reading and then state_lock.

pwrseq_device_unregister() is the only exception, it takes: state_lock,
then rw_lock for writing and finally pwrseq_sem for writing. This created
two potential ABBA deadlock situations that sashiko pointed out.

  - pwrseq_power_on/off() take rw_lock for reading then state_lock, while
    pwrseq_unregister() takes state_lock then rw_lock for writing
  - pwrseq_get() takes pwrseq_sem for reading then rw_lock for reading,
    while pwrseq_unregister() takes rw_lock for writing then pwrseq_sem
    for writing

Reorder the unregister path to taking pwrseq_sem for writing -&gt; rw_lock
for writing and drop the state_lock entirely. This is safe as
enable_count is only ever written under rw_lock held for read (via
pwrseq_unit_enable()/disable(), reached only from pwrseq_power_on/off()),
so holding rw_lock for writing already excludes every other writer and
reader and the active-users WARN() stays race-free without state_lock.

<title>pwrseq: core: fix use-after-free in pwrseq_debugfs_seq_next()</title>

pwrseq_debugfs_seq_next() declares 'next' with __free(put_device),
which causes put_device() to be called on the returned pointer when
the variable goes out of scope.  This results in a use-after-free
since the seq_file framework receives a pointer whose reference has
already been dropped.

Simply removing __free(put_device) would fix the UAF but would leak
the reference acquired by bus_find_next_device(), as stop() only
calls up_read(&amp;pwrseq_sem) and never releases the device reference.

Fix this by making the reference counting consistent across all
seq_file callbacks, matching the standard pattern used by PCI and
SCSI:

- start(): use get_device() so it returns a referenced pointer.
- next(): explicitly put_device(curr) to release the previous
  device's reference (no NULL check needed - the seq_file framework
  only calls next() while the previous return was non-NULL).
- stop(): put_device(data) to release the last iterated device's
  reference, with a NULL guard since stop() may be called with NULL
  when start() returned NULL or next() reached end-of-sequence.
